Seagate has 3GBps Serial ATA setup

Stunning
Wed Sep 15 2004, 10:15
SEAGATE HAD A 3GBPS SATA setup at IDF last week, a first as far as I am aware. While some have shown multiple 1.5GB drives connected to a 3GBps controller with a port multiplier, Seagate had the real deal. It was stunning, even to a sarcastic person like me, see?

Yes, I know, it is really, amazingly dull to look at, but I have to spin a couple of boxes and an oscilloscope somehow. For the squinty eyed among you, the eye on the oscilloscope is blurry because the drive is doing random reads and writes. It is clean though, and that is what matters.

Seagate-3gbps-drive-demo

The point is that both drives and controllers are working as of last week. Products that take advantage of the increased bandwidth are coming to the market soon, and with a four way port multiplier, things suddenly get quite interesting. µ
